Reduce Energy Needs With TreeFolks Program

Interested in adding tree cover to your home to lower house temps and reduce energy bills?

TreeFolks, a local non-profit, will be offering free trees in the neighborhood through their NeighborWoods program. They will mark yards that qualify for a free street tree with small flags and leave an order form at the front door. To get your trees, TreeFolks ask that you fill out the order card and drop it in the mail. They even deliver the tree right to your doorstep. TreeFolks delivers the trees, along with planting and watering instructions, between October and March. For more information, visit www.treefolks.org/nw.

TreeFolks is a 501©3 nonprofit organization with a mission to grow the urban forest of Central Texas through tree planting, education and community partnerships. It gives away over 4,000 free trees every year to homeowners for planting around the home through the NeighborWoods program (sponsored by Austin Energy). Planting trees decreases energy bills, provides cooling shade during our hot summers, and makes our neighborhoods more beautiful. Participation in the program is completely free, and we deliver the trees directly to the home.

The only ‘catch’ is that you have to plant and care for the trees!
